The station, operated by Southern Railway, is equipped with a variety of facilities and amenities that cater to a wide range of passenger needs.
At Eastbourne Station, buying and collecting train tickets is a breeze. The ticket office is open daily, with operating hours from 6:00 AM to 9:15 PM during weekdays and slightly adjusted weekend times. Whether you prefer traditional service at the ticket counters or the convenience of ticket machines, Eastbourne station has you covered. For travelers with disabilities, all Southern ticket machines can handle transactions with a Disabled Persons Railcard, and induction loops are available to assist hearing-impaired passengers.
Accessibility is key at Eastbourne. The station provides step-free access throughout the premises, ensuring a smooth journey for everyone. While there may not be tactile surfaces along all platform edges, help is always available either by staff on site or through assistance pre-arranged for your journey. This station caters largely to spontaneous travelers with its "turn up and go" policy for people requiring additional support.
Although there is no waiting room, you’ll find seating areas and a multitude of customer help points spread across the station. Moreover, Eastbourne Station is under constant CCTV monitoring, contributing to a secure environment for all passengers. For those who prefer two-wheeled travel, the station offers ample bike storage, albeit without a sheltered facility or a hiring service.
Transport links at Eastbourne are robust, seamlessly connecting rail travelers to buses, taxis, and other local transit options. A convenient taxi rank is situated at the west side of the station, ready to whisk travelers to various destinations around town. Though modest in size, Glasshoughton station is more than equipped to handle your travel needs. While there is no ticket office on site, rest assured that ticket machines are readily available, ensuring that buying or collecting your pre-purchased tickets is a breeze. Smartcard facilities are available too, and the machines have been designed to be accessible for all.
If assistance is needed during your visit, customer help points are stationed strategically to guide and aid passengers. Although there's no staffed support, emergency helpline details are prominently displayed to assist in case you require further help. Security is also a priority here, with CCTV in place and maintained across the station.
Accessing the platforms at Glasshoughton involves a series of ramps and a footbridge, making it accessible for those who need step-free entries. Although the route between platforms is somewhat lengthy, it ensures that all passengers can use the station. If you need extra assistance for train access, all Northern trains carry ramps, and help is always available through Passenger Assist services, which can be arranged in advance.
When you need to get beyond the station, a few reliable options await you. Bus services are easily accessible, with a service bus stop located adjacent to the station where rail replacement services also operate. Taxis are another option, and you can find more information here should you need to hire one. Bicycle storage is available on Platform 2, with both cycle lockers and stands to keep your bike safe while you travel.
